Neighborhood Overview – Multicultural Arts High School
Multicultural Arts High School is situated in the vibrant Archer Heights neighborhood on Chicago's Southwest Side. This area is a tapestry of residential streets, local businesses, and accessible green spaces, offering a genuine Chicago community feel. The school is strategically located with convenient access to major thoroughfares, including the Stevenson Expressway (I-55) and Pulaski Road, facilitating easy travel across the city. For those arriving by air, Midway International Airport (MDW) is remarkably close, typically a short 10-15 minute drive depending on traffic conditions. Public transportation is robust, with multiple CTA bus lines serving the vicinity and the Orange Line's Midway station offering a quick connection to downtown and other key areas. Parking in the immediate vicinity of the school can be tight, especially during school hours or local events, so planning your arrival with extra time is highly recommended. Understanding the flow of local traffic, particularly during peak commute times on nearby Pulaski Road and Archer Avenue, will help ensure a more relaxed journey to and from the school.

Weather & Seasons
Winter
Chicago winters are cold, with average temperatures often dipping below freezing. Expect brisk winds and the possibility of snow. Visitors should pack heavy coats, hats, gloves, and waterproof footwear to stay warm and comfortable when traveling to and from the school. Indoor activities and timely transit are key to enjoying this season.
Spring & early summer
Spring transitions through cool and then warming temperatures, with increasing chances of rain. Early summer remains pleasantly mild to warm. Layering clothing is advisable, as mornings can be cool while afternoons warm up considerably. Light jackets or sweaters are useful, and always check the forecast for rain showers.
Mid-summer
Mid-summer in Chicago is typically warm to hot and humid. Lightweight, breathable clothing is recommended. Sunscreen, hats, and sunglasses are essential for any outdoor activities, and staying hydrated is important. Evenings can offer a slight cooling, but generally, summer demands preparation for heat.
Fall season
Fall brings crisp air and gradually cooling temperatures, with vibrant foliage often appearing in local parks. Days are pleasant, but evenings can become chilly. Packing layers, including a medium-weight jacket or sweater, is a good strategy for adapting to the changing weather. This season is often ideal for comfortable exploration.
Rain & snow
Chicago experiences both significant rainfall, particularly in spring and summer, and snowfall throughout its winter months. Be prepared for potential travel disruptions due to weather conditions. Carry an umbrella during warmer months and ensure footwear is suitable for wet or snowy conditions. Timely departures and checking local transit updates are crucial during inclement weather.
